Challenges of Traditional Travel Guides
Traditional travel guides, often in the form of thick brochures or books, have long been a go-to resource for tourists exploring new destinations. However, they face several challenges in today’s diverse and interconnected world. One significant hurdle is language barriers; many popular travel spots around the globe speak a multitude of languages, making it difficult to cater to non-native speakers effectively. While some guides offer basic translations, they often fall short of capturing the nuances and cultural contexts that make a destination truly memorable.
Moreover, static travel guides struggle to keep up with dynamic cities and regions, where new attractions, restaurants, and local events emerge frequently. This obsolescence can leave travelers with outdated information, potentially leading to subpar experiences or missed opportunities. In today’s digital age, many travelers also expect instant, accessible information, making the traditional guide less appealing for those who rely on their smartphones as their primary navigation tool. Effective Translation Strategies for Brochures
To effectively reach new travelers with translated UK travel guides and brochures, consider strategic translation techniques that go beyond literal word-for-word substitutions. Professional translation services understand that cultural nuances and local idiomatic expressions play a significant role in communication. Therefore, they employ translators who are not just linguistic experts but also have a deep understanding of the destination’s culture and tourism industry.
This involves translating not just words but also capturing the essence and spirit of the original content. Using native language terms that resonate with potential visitors, ensuring clarity in instructions and descriptions, and maintaining a consistent tone throughout the guide are essential. Moreover, incorporating visual elements like maps, illustrations, and high-quality images can enhance the translated brochure’s appeal, making it more engaging and useful for tourists from diverse linguistic backgrounds.
